Quiz Answer Key and Fun Facts
1. "I sit at the end of a long road, near the ocean. I think this is California, but I can't be sure. A young boy and his friend came here, and took a very powerful thing out of one of my rooms. Now I think I might be dying."

Answer: The Black Hotel

The Black Hotel is in "The Talisman". Jack and Richard travel through the blasted lands on the train to reach it. Jack goes inside, and takes the Talisman out. The hotel is then virtually dead, all the power taken from it, with the Talisman.
2. "I sit on top of a hill. I was vacant for a many years. My previous owner hung himself in one of my rooms. Recently, someone has moved in, and I think something fishy is going on. He sleeps in a large box in my celler, and only comes out at night. I think he is evil."

Answer: The Marsten House

The Marsten House is in "Salem's Lot", and is owned by Straker and his partner. He keeps his coffin in the celler, where no sunlight can find him. Its previous owner, Marsten, hung himself in one of the bedrooms. Kids used to dare each other in Salem's Lot, to go inside and bring something out.
3. "I live on a large lake, and my view is beautiful. I have ghosts living in me, some good, but most bad. My owner's wife died recently, and he has come to stay. He must fight some of these ghosts, to keep me, and the little girl."

Answer: Sara Laughs

Sara Laughs is in the book "Bag of Bones". She is haunted by Sara Tidwell, and Joanne. Both are at odds with each other, and when Mike has to save his friend's little girl from being drowned, he has to relive the horrible rape and murder of Sara Tidwell and her son.

She is out for revenge, and he isn't willing to let her take the little girl, who is the last of the decendents of the horrible men who raped her, and killed her son.
4. "I was never named. I am a summer home for a very famous writer, who has an alter ego. Someone found out about him, and threatened to expose him. He kills off his alter ego, and it comes out of fantasy to take over his life. What book am I from?"

Answer: The Dark Half

In "The Dark Half", Thad Beaumont's alter ego, George Stark, tries to take over his life after Thad kills him off. He traps Thad in his summer home in Castle Rock, to write one more book. Thad wins in the end, when the sparrows come and take George away.
5. "I live in the moutains, where winter is my favorite time of year. That is when all the fun starts. I have many ghosts living within my walls, and they are planning to take the little boy living here now. I am excited to see how it all works out, since the father has lost his mind, and has tried to kill the mother. I wounder if the boy will survive."

Answer: The Overlook Hotel

The Overlook Hotel is in "The Shining". Jack, Wendy and Danny decide to stay at The Overlook, when Jack is offered the job as winter caretaker. The ghosts in and around the hotel want Danny for his special power, and use Jack to try to kill him. In the end, Wendy and Danny get away with Dick Halloran, just before the hotel explodes. Jack forgot to check the boiler, and it did him in.
6. "I don't have a name. I live on a small street, where no one really notices me. Lots of bad things live in me. Seven kids came here, trying to find one of those bad things, and they were almost killed. They got in through the basement, and left the same way. When they left, I felt a lot of the bad things leave too. Now I think I'm just a run down house again. Too bad. What book am I from?"

Answer: It

The house on Neibolt Street is in the book "It." The Loosers Club, Mike, Stan, Richie, Eddie, Ben, and Bev, go into the house to try to find Pennywise, and It almost kills them. They get out, and everything that made the house evil is gone. It's just another house, not a portal for It.
7. "I am a very big house, too big, with too many rooms. Some of my rooms make no sense, at least to most. Nine people came into me, to try and wake me up. They succeeded in angering me, and the ghosts that live here. I only take women, and kill men. A little girl is with them, a very special little girl."

Answer: Rose Red

"Rose Red", is a made for t.v. mini-series, that takes place in a huge mansion on the outskirts of Seattle. The house it actually alive, taking women into itself, and killing men at random. Ellen Rimbauer built so many rooms in her house, that no one can seem to keep track of them.

Her only decendent takes a group of gifted people into her, and they do succeed in waking her up, which turns out to be a very bad thing.
8. "I live at the end of a dirt road, a road that most people can't find. I am painted a very odd color, and have been said not to cast any shadows. A small boy is locked in one of my rooms, and four men have come for him. They enter me, by following a bee. I can't wait to see what happens next."

Answer: Black House

"Black House" takes place in French Landing. The house was built by Charles Bernside. He painted the entire house black, which is where it got its name. Many evil things live there, and when Tyler Marshall is kidnapped by Charles, he hides him there. Jack, Beezer, Doc and Dale follow a bee into the house, to find him.

They enter another world, and find not only Tyler, but thousands more like him.
9. "I live up in the woods, where hunting is good. I'm not actually haunted, but a horrible thing has now happened within my walls. A man was found outside, and brought in. Inside of him an evil thing lives, and now it's out. It has killed one of the men staying here, and taken over the other. I think I might be dying, because red stuff is growing on my walls." What novel is this place from?

Answer: Dreamcatcher

The Hole In The Wall is a cabin in the woods where the men from "The Dreamcatcher" go, to reunite, and just bond again. They keep a large dreamcatcher hanging from the ceiling, to remind them of their sick friend. A man is found wandering outside. He had been lost, and cold.

They try to help him, but later on that night, a large snake-looking thing comes out of him. It kills one of them, and takes over the other's body. The cabin then is infected with red fungus, and one of the other men burns it down.
10. "I am not a house, or hotel. I am a sort of Station. I have no name, but I see people sometimes. Just recently there was a young boy living here. Then a dark man came through, and left quickly. He scared the boy. Now, a tall rugged looking fellow is here. He found the spirit living in my basement, and I think he is taking the boy with him when he leaves. What book am I from."

Answer: The Gunslinger

In "The Gunslinger", Roland finds Jake at the Weigh Station. He also finds a spirit in the basement, and takes a jaw bone from it. He uses it later to deafeat the man in black, after letting Jake die. I know it's not a Hotel or House, but I thought that this was a good one for this quiz.
